What are Lactose-Free Yogurts minimum order quantities (MOQ)?
For Lactose-Free Yogurts, the minimum order quantities (MOQs) vary based on whether you are looking for branded or private label products. Branded products typically have MOQs ranging from 1,000 to 3,000 units, while private label options start from 100,000 to 300,000 units. This flexibility allows businesses to choose quantities that best fit their sourcing strategies, whether they are catering to smaller boutique operations or large-scale retail chains.
